BWW Review: SONDHEIM UNPLUGGED Triumphantly Returns at 54 Below by Ricky Pope - Jul 26, 2021

Before the end of the first song, there was thunderous applause at the return of SONDHEIM UNPLUGGED to 54 Below after having been absent, in fact, all of last year. For those of you, like me, who have never been to a SONDHEIM UNPLUGGED show, it is the creation of impresario Phil Geoffrey Bond. It is a simple concept. It is a monthly event at which he gathers a group of guest stars who sing songs by Stephen Sondheim, accompanied only by a piano. The entire evening is hosted and curated by Mr. Bond who also provides tidbits of history and trivia about the songs we are hearing. The series is in its eleventh season. Tonight’s show was number 93.

Welcome to the Club has had 3 productions including Regional (US) which opened in 1988, Broadway which opened in 1989 and Broadway which opened in 1989.
Welcome to the Club has been nominated for the Tony Award for Best Direction of a Musical, with Peter Mark Schifter being the nominee.
